TEXAN FOR THE TAKING – Charlene Sands
Boone Brothers of Texas , Book 1
Harlequin Desire #2661
ISBN: 978-1-335-60363-0
May 2019
Contemporary Series Romance

Boone Springs, Texas – Present Day

Event planner Drea MacDonald returns to her hometown of Boone Springs, well aware that she will likely run into her first love, wealthy rancher Mason Boone, since it is his event fundraiser that brought her back. Drea hasn't forgiven Mason for rejecting her when she was seventeen. All she wanted to do was show him how much she loved him by giving her virginity, but he flatly turned her down. This rejection caused her to do some unfortunate things and it continues to haunt her to this day. But Mason is different now, especially since he was widowed two years ago. Yet, there are sparks flying between Mason and Drea that confuse her. Why does she still want him? Will it lead to anything more than just hot looks between them?

Mason loved his late wife, who died from a heart condition, and he is honoring her memory by building a wing at the local hospital in her honor. He hasn't yet gotten back into the dating pool as he is still mourning. But the return of Drea—and the realization that he's attracted to her—has him rethinking his celibate ways. While her time in Boone Springs is only until the event happens, Mason has to tread carefully because her father does continue to live nearby. Add in that she blames Mason's family for her father losing the family ranch, let's just say there is some animosity between them, but that the passion of hate also begets sexual attraction.

TEXAN FOR THE TAKING is the first book in the Boone Brothers of Texas series about the family for whom the town of Boone Springs is named. The brothers are attractive and wealthy, which makes them ripe for some sexy reading as they each find their mates. Mason is the oldest, and the one who thought his love life was over after losing his wife (and unborn child). But Drea, a woman from his past, has the flames kindling between them. In TEXAN FOR THE TAKING, Mason has to struggle whether he is over his late wife and ready to move on. Drea is strong, beautiful, and a fighter. Will she fight for Mason's love?

In TEXAN FOR THE TAKING, Mason and Drea's relationship is both hot and cold at times. She didn't want to love him, though it's clear that he has her heart. She doesn't want to be second best in Mason's heart and tries to push him away, but the sexual attraction between them soon has her back in his bed. It will take nearly losing Drea before he finally sees the light. A passionate and endearing tale don't miss TEXAN FOR THE TAKING.
